Sha256: 461eb6d7a51443e96a1f7476d06b9ba9e5daec6d0ae5f85f5d27be672ef5963e

Contents?: true

Size: 636 Bytes

Versions: 44

Compression:

Stored size: 636 Bytes

Contents

module FbGraph
  module Connections
    module Milestones
      def milestones(options = {})
        milestones = self.connection :milestones, options
        milestones.map! do |milestone|
          Milestone.new milestone[:id], milestone.merge(
            :access_token => options[:access_token] || self.access_token
          )
        end
      end

      def milestone!(options = {})
        milestone = post options.merge(:connection => :milestones)
        Milestone.new milestone[:id], options.merge(milestone).merge(
          :access_token => options[:access_token] || self.access_token
        )
      end
    end
  end
end

Version data entries

44 entries across 44 versions & 1 rubygems

Version Path
fb_graph-2.4.16 lib/fb_graph/connections/milestones.rb
fb_graph-2.4.15 lib/fb_graph/connections/milestones.rb
fb_graph-2.4.14 lib/fb_graph/connections/milestones.rb
fb_graph-2.4.13 lib/fb_graph/connections/milestones.rb